Dear Li Rong,
I am pleased to officially inform you that Pacific Environment is awarding a grant in the sum of $3,000 U.S. dollars to Hainan Green Sunshine for work on coral conservation as described in your proposal and in keeping with the following budget.
Project Budget (U.S. Dollars)
Activity
| Amount ($)
| Website (domain rental for 4 years)
| $40
| Coral education materials competition (publicity, awards)
| $60
| Publication and printing of coral education materials (brochures, posters, Children’s education book, etc.)
| $1040
| Green Camp (supplies, transportation, accommodation, materials, etc.)
| $700
| Coral Trade Investigation (transportation, publication, survey development and publication)
| $770
| Final outreach activities summarizing work (presentations, summary cd)
| $200
| Administrative Costs (postage, telephone fees, misc. supplies, etc).
| $190
| TOTAL
| $3000
|
Pacific Environment is a non-profit, non-commercial organization registered in the United States with a 501c3 (tax-exempt) status. This grant is a charitable donation that can be used only for the purpose of protecting the environment or increasing the capacity of your organization. The grant cannot be used for lobbying or political purposes.
By signing this agreement, you are confirming the following:
Your organization is the equivalent of a non-profit organization according to the laws and regulations of the United States. [/li]As is so with Pacific Environment, your organization will use the funds for public, charitable activities, and will not receive nor plans to receive personal gain from the use of these funds. These funds will only be used for their indicated purpose, and will not be used to make a profit in any form. [/li]The results of the completed project are for the benefit of the public. Pacific Environment has no claim on these results. [/li]As is so with Pacific Environment, your organization will not use these funds for lobbying or support of political activities. [/li]Your organization will seek Pacific Environment’s approval in advance before making changes to project plans or project completion dates, and will inform us about any situations that could prevent your successful completion of the project. [/li]Your organization must provide Pacific Environment written reports in Chinese or English: midterm reports (financial and narrative) by November 15, 2007, and final reports (financial and narrative) by February 15, 2008. These reports should include information about the progress toward accomplishing the project’s goals as well as the problems that could prevent your success. Your reports must be submitted via email to Daniela Salaverry at dsalaverry@pacificenvironment.org. The grant will be given in two installments $1500 and $1500. The second installment will be sent after we receive and approve the midterm reports. Your organization takes responsibility for bank fees, including fees for the wire transfer. Please note: These funds will be wired to Wen Bo for distribution to your group. [/li]Your organization must comply with relevant Chinese laws throughout the course of the project, and takes full responsibility for any violation of Chinese law. The grant funds cannot be used to pay fines or other penalties assigned to your organization. [/li]Your organization bears responsibility for the authenticity of the information contained in your project’s financial documentation. Pacific Environment retains the right to request additional documentation for the purposes of a financial audit.[/li] 9. Within the previously approved budget, you can redistribute the project’s budget line item amounts as long as these changes do not exceed 10% of the overall sum of the grant. Otherwise, Pacific Environment must give prior written agreement for redistribution of the budget. To do this, send Pacific Environment a letter requesting approval for the changes to the budget. The changes will go into effect after you receive a letter from Pacific Environment confirming approval. The letter will be considered an addendum to this agreement.
10. If reports are not received or are of insufficient quality, or funds have been used improperly, or this agreement is otherwise violated, Pacific Environment retains the right to cancel this agreement and demand the return of unused funds.
11. At the end of the project Pacific Environment will send your organization a closing letter. This letter signifies that we approve your project’s results and confirm that the funds were used correctly. This letter does not qualify as a claim on the results of the project.
12. Your organization will retain all financial documentation related to the expenditures of the grant funds, and if necessary, will provide Pacific Environment staff access to it.
13. All publications of the grant recipient are the property of the grant recipient. We ask your organization to send Pacific Environment a few copies of any related publications, as an addendum to the project report.
14. When you make reference to your organization’s sources of funding, you can cite Pacific Environment.
15. We ask if you produce written publications with this support, that you indicate that the publication was supported by Pacific Environment. This is required in order to verify that the grant funds are being used appropriately, and does not constitute an advertisement for Pacific Environment.
